一、數(shù)學(xué)建模與編程?
如果你C語言很熟悉的話完全可以,C++只是在C語言的基礎(chǔ)上做了一些擴(kuò)展,在解決數(shù)學(xué)建模上兩者是差不多的。
不過建議你用MATLAB,它對(duì)于許多數(shù)學(xué)矩陣上的運(yùn)算十分方便。編程不是建模的重點(diǎn),但是又是必要的一個(gè)環(huán)節(jié),掌握一門編程語言才能很好地把握建模的過程。二、數(shù)學(xué)建模中建模和編程哪個(gè)難?
建模更難,建模通俗來講就是通過三維制作軟件通過虛擬三維空間構(gòu)建出具有三維數(shù)據(jù)的模型。建模大概可分為:NURBS和多邊形網(wǎng)格。
NURBS對(duì)要求精細(xì)、彈性與復(fù)雜的模型有較好的應(yīng)用,適合量化生產(chǎn)用途。多邊形網(wǎng)格建模是靠拉面方式,適合做效果圖與復(fù)雜場景動(dòng)畫。綜合說來各有長處
三、圖解建模編程工具大全,助你快速掌握建模編程
什么是建模編程工具?
建模編程工具是一類幫助開發(fā)人員進(jìn)行軟件建模和編程的工具,它們通過圖形化的界面和強(qiáng)大的功能,提供了一種更加直觀和高效的開發(fā)方式。
常見的建模編程工具有哪些?
下面是一些常見的建模編程工具:
- UML建模工具:UML(Unified Modeling Language)是一種常用的軟件工程建模語言,UML建模工具可以幫助開發(fā)人員進(jìn)行需求分析、系統(tǒng)設(shè)計(jì)和代碼生成等工作。
- Blockly:Blockly是一款流行的可視化編程工具,它通過拖拽和連接積木塊的方式,讓編程變得簡單易學(xué),適合初學(xué)者和兒童使用。
- Scratch:Scratch是一款圖形化編程語言,它不僅可以幫助用戶創(chuàng)建動(dòng)畫和游戲,還可以培養(yǎng)邏輯思維和計(jì)算思維。
- Visio:Visio是一款流行的繪圖工具,它可以用于繪制各種類型的圖表和流程圖,也可以用于軟件建模和系統(tǒng)設(shè)計(jì)。
- LabVIEW:LabVIEW是一款用于控制系統(tǒng)和測量系統(tǒng)的圖形化開發(fā)環(huán)境,它可以用于創(chuàng)建各種類型的虛擬儀器和系統(tǒng)。
- Modelio:Modelio是一款開源的UML建模工具,它支持多種UML圖形和模型,可以幫助開發(fā)人員進(jìn)行軟件建模和系統(tǒng)設(shè)計(jì)。
如何選擇合適的建模編程工具?
選擇合適的建模編程工具需要根據(jù)具體的需求和使用場景來進(jìn)行評(píng)估:
- 功能:不同的建模編程工具提供的功能各有不同,需要根據(jù)自己的需求選擇適合的工具。
- 易用性:一款好的建模編程工具應(yīng)該具有良好的用戶界面和易上手的操作方式,能夠讓開發(fā)人員快速上手。
- 擴(kuò)展性:一些工具提供了豐富的擴(kuò)展插件和API,開發(fā)人員可以根據(jù)自己的需要進(jìn)行定制和擴(kuò)展。
- 社區(qū)支持:一些工具擁有活躍的社區(qū)和廣泛的用戶群體,這意味著你可以獲得更多的支持和資源。
建模編程工具的優(yōu)勢和應(yīng)用場景
建模編程工具具有以下優(yōu)勢和應(yīng)用場景:
- 提高開發(fā)效率:建模編程工具通過圖形化的界面和自動(dòng)生成代碼的功能,能夠大幅度提高開發(fā)效率。
- 降低編程難度:對(duì)于初學(xué)者和非專業(yè)人士來說,使用建模編程工具可以降低編程的學(xué)習(xí)難度。
- 提升可視化能力:通過建模編程工具,開發(fā)人員可以將抽象的想法和邏輯轉(zhuǎn)化為可視化的圖形,提升項(xiàng)目的可視化能力。
- 促進(jìn)協(xié)作與溝通:建模編程工具可以促進(jìn)團(tuán)隊(duì)成員之間的協(xié)作與溝通,提高項(xiàng)目的整體效率。
通過使用合適的建模編程工具,開發(fā)人員可以更加高效地進(jìn)行軟件建模和編程,提高項(xiàng)目的質(zhì)量和效率。
感謝您閱讀本文,希望通過閱讀本文,您對(duì)建模編程工具有了更深入的了解,同時(shí)也能夠幫助您選擇合適的工具來進(jìn)行軟件建模和編程。
四、ug編程建模必備技巧?
1、層可以命名、分類
為了便于記憶以及方便他人修改,層可以命名分類。剛開始覺得不方便,用習(xí)慣了會(huì)發(fā)現(xiàn)它的好處,特別是開發(fā)大型零部件時(shí)。
2、層可以方便出圖。
有時(shí),出圖時(shí)要將某一層的東西關(guān)閉掉。比如你要將汽缸的蓋子打開,出一張俯視圖。或者在某些大型裝配時(shí),你只要顯示某一層的內(nèi)容。
3、關(guān)閉不工作的層,加快顯示速度
出圖時(shí)為了加快顯示速度,通常可以將不需要的層關(guān)閉。有時(shí)還需要將某些視圖關(guān)閉,設(shè)為inactive 一般來說,越是大型裝配,層越重要。所以要養(yǎng)成好習(xí)慣。
五、proe可以編程建模么?
proe